摘要
在棉花花铃期膜下滴施不同量尿素,结果表明,追氮处理后棉株根、叶片、叶柄和蕾铃的氮含量比不追氮处理要高,但增高多少与追氮量没有明显关系。棉花总吸氮量随着追氮量的增加而增加,但花铃期吸氮量占总吸氮量的比例呈下降趋势。追氮处理对土壤全氮没有明显的影响,但对土壤碱解氮的影响比较大。土壤全氮和碱解氮与棉花各器官氮含量的相关性不显著。随着施氮量增加,追施氮肥的利用率明显下降。
Topdress different amount urea on cotton under film- mulching and drip irrigation during the blooming period, the result showed that content of nitrogen of root, leaf, leaf- stem and reproductive organ of cotton with nitrog entreatment were higher than non - treatment, but the increase had no relation with the amount of nitrogen topdressing. The total absorption of nitrogen increased with the amount of nitrogen topdressing, but the proportion of absorption nitrogen during the blooming period to total nitrogen were downtrend. Topdressing nitrogen treatment had no obvious effect to total nitrogen in soil, but it had a stronger effect to alkalined - nitrogen. There had no significant correlation between content nitrogen of cotton organs and total nitrogen and alkalined-nitmgen in soil.The nitrogen utilization efficiency were downtrend with the amount of topdressing increased.
